objective-c - 为 NSTabviewitem 添加一个关闭按钮

标签 objective-c cocoa xcode nsbutton nstabview

当用户单击菜单(例如“客户端数据”)时,我有一个带有选项卡 View 的应用程序,我以编程方式生成一个选项卡。现在我想子类化选项卡 View ,为每个 NSTabviewitem 添加一个关闭按钮。如果您没有答案,您可以帮助提供文档或示例代码

最佳答案

我知道这个问题很古老,但是......

我花了一些时间尝试使用自定义子类向 NSTabViewItems 添加按钮,据我所知这是不可能的。 NSTabViewItem 的可定制性不足以完成这项工作。

我的建议是看看chromium-tabs或者也许 PSMTabBarControl ;它们的外观与标准 NSTabViewItems 不同,但为图标和关闭按钮提供开箱即用的功能。

关于objective-c - 为 NSTabviewitem 添加一个关闭按钮,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5898951/

相关文章:

iphone - Xcode:无法在更新时启动应用程序

objective-c - 禁用每个 NSView 的活力

ios - 是否可以在不显示 MPMediaPickerController 的情况下显示 ios 中的所有歌曲

iphone - XCode 核心数据中的错误 : Expected specifier-qualifier-list before . ..

cocoa - 按数组中包含的 int 对 NSArray 进行排序

ios - XCode UITests 无法运行并出现意外退出错误(仅限机器人)

iphone - 将数据添加到 NSDictionary...SRSLY?难道就没有更快的方法吗?

objective-c - 如何使用 XCode 中的用户名/密码登录网站?

ios - 如何使用 NSURLConnection 获取呈现的 javascript 源

xcode - 在 xcode5 中在 .h 和 .m 文件之间切换的快捷方式